Definition:
This is refers to the Five Pillars of faith, which encompass the five fundamental
beliefs and actions which are required of all Muslims. They are: shahadah,
salat, zakat, sawm and hajj.
Also Known As: Five Pillars of Islam, Five Pillars of Faith
